PostPosted: Tue Apr 24, 2012 00:48    Post subject:  Crash on connection
Subject description: Memory Cannot be 'Read' error
 

Every time I try to connect to a TSGK server, the game will crash within seconds with a 'Memory Cannot be Read' error. Don't know what's causing it, but only appears to happen on a TSGK server.

I've already tried purging the downloads and cache folder to no avail.
